Tuition and Fees

The fee for College of Business and Economics online undergraduate courses is $375 per online credit. The per unit fee applies to every student, resident and non-resident, who chooses to take an online undergraduate business class.

The unit fee for online undergraduate courses will increase with in-state tuition on a dollar-for-dollar basis.  For example, if in-state tuition increases $18 per credit in Fall 2012, the online course fee will also increase $18 per credit.  

UW-System identifies tuition increases for the Fall semester each year.  Online tuition fees will remain stable throughout the entire school year.  

* 12 credits is considered full-time enrollment.

Textbooks

At UW-Whitewater, students rent their textbooks through the University Bookstore Textbook Rental program.  This program provides basic required textbooks, CD-ROMs and other non-consumable materials, for students enrolled in undergraduate courses. Textbook Rental is included in tuition, and results in a substantial cost savings to students. Students may have to purchase books (workbooks, paperback books, etc.) or items (such as art supplies) that are considered perishable in nature.

Financial Aid

Financial Assistance is available to UW-Whitewater students in the form of grants, loans, and employment. All these aids make up a "Financial Aid Package" and may be offered singly or in various combinations. Grants are financial assistance which do not have to be repaid, while loans must be repaid. Since funds are limited, priority for aid is based on financial need and how promptly applications are filed.
